It looks like you synced the resources from Accordance on another computer. When you do that, the iOS version assumes that you put the resources in order on that computer for a reason and puts them in the same order on the iOS version. There isn't a way to automatically sort them alphabetically, but you can change the order by going to the library, tapping Edit, and then dragging them into whatever order you wish.

The only other thing I can think of is to delete everything and install it using Easy Install directly on the device. Easy Install sorts the modules alphabetically by an abbreviated name, so I would guess they would be installed in the same order (though I'm not certain of that). However, manually rearranging doesn't really take too long (I've done it a bunch of times because I prefer a different order on iOS than on my laptop) and would certainly be faster than waiting for the modules to download from the internet.

Go to library then to the category i.e. "English Tools", control click on the first resource then select "alphabetize".

That works on the desktop version of Accordance, but his question is for iOS. However, if you also want the resources alphabetized on your computer, you can follow Bob's suggestion and then sync that order over to iOS (you may need to delete the modules off of the iOS device first).
